Output d302586adbf2d26fdb08b6f7672dafa4aef6a9a587433947cbb825f63ce46d37:1

value
54380722
script pubkey
OP_0 OP_PUSHBYTES_32 de08433c2b1908ac53b7bc167be0bba68aaae82b0bbab9d08dabef50ce99011d
address
bc1qmcyyx0ptryy2c5ahhst8hc9m569246ptpwatn5yd40h4pn5eqywsw86s9a
transaction
d302586adbf2d26fdb08b6f7672dafa4aef6a9a587433947cbb825f63ce46d37
spent
true